Overview
The Xamarin.Forms Switch allows you to turn an item on and off, and provides an optional indeterminate state. It supports VSM, a busy state, and gradient.
Visual types
The Xamarin.Forms Switch provides three built-in visual types. These visual types save time when customizing a switch based on different devices in maintaining the same visual on all three kinds of devices (Android, iOS, and UWP).



Indeterminate state
Apart from the usual on and off states, there is also a state called indeterminate.

Visual State Manager
Use the Visual State Manager to customize Xamarin.Forms Switch’s thumb and track based on switch states. Its supported visual states are on, off, indeterminate, and disabled.

Busy indicator
Switches with busy indicator support are the most common scenario in service-based apps. The Xamarin.Forms Switch can turn on or off items based on validation.

Orientation
The Xamarin.Forms Switch supports vertical orientation. The Xamarin.Forms Switch can be integrated when the app requires an interface to set values at high, low, and medium.

Gradients
The highly customizable Xamarin.Forms Switch control allows you to customize its background with gradients.

Images
Customize the Xamarin.Forms Switch control with images to illustrate the use case of the switch action.

Can I download and utilize the Syncfusion Xamarin Switch for free?
No, this is a commercial product and requires a paid license. However, a free community license is also available for companies and individuals whose organizations have less than $1 million USD in annual gross revenue, 5 or fewer developers, and 10 or fewer total employees.
